Safety and efficacy of high-dose fomepizole compared with ethanol as therapy for ethylene glycol intoxication in cats

Abstract

Fomepizole is safe when administered to cats in high doses, prevents EG-induced fatal ARF when therapy is instituted within 3 hours of EG ingestion, and is more effective than treatment with EtOH.
